d.22 on Vaillant Home System

This is actually a status indicator rather than a fault, showing whether your boiler 'thinks' your hot water tank is currently asking for heat.

What the manual says

Manufacturer manual

Status of the hot water request: off=No current requirement, on=Current requirement

DIY fix possible

Check your hot water cylinder thermostat and time clock to ensure they are set to 'on'.Open the hot water tap to see if the status changes from 'off' to 'on'.No action is required if your hot water is currently working as intended.
